About the Event
AAJ Education is providing this nationwide webinar that help attorneys streamline the Medicare lien process for their current and future cases. During this webinar, attendees will receive an overview of how to find out what your client owes, negotiate liens for payments made, discuss the actual obligations for liability insurance, and receive an informative legislative update from AAJ.
